What is borax?
It's a naturally occurring salt of boron, often sold in North America as a laundry additive. I answer some questions about it in the follow-up video: ruclips.net/video/Wfj-naVG8yM/видео.html

Using bait traps require extreme diligence in making sure they never run out of liquid, until the queen (or queens) have perished from ingesting the poison (borax), and is why most people don't think bait traps/liquid work. This same treatment also works for in-ground yellow jackets. Of course for yellow jackets there are some extra precautions and procedures you would want to follow.
First, before you even begin to approach the entrance to their in-ground hive/nest, you want to wait no less than two hours after the sun has completely set.... and even then you want to approach with caution.
Pre plan what you are going to do and do it quickly. Have everything you need at your finger tips, and plan your escape route.
You may even want to practice your plan, less the water, in another similar area nearby.
I would use a five quart pan of boiling water and a good squirt of Dawn dishwashing soap.
Approach the entrance.
Pour the water in the hole.
Cover it with a six inch square screen.
Place bricks or rocks on the screen to hold it down.
Walk away and go in for the night.
Check it out the next day and evaluate your results and see if further action is necessary.

I do something similar: I mix even parts of Borax and non-dairy coffee creamer, grind them to even consistencies with a mortar and pestle, then put it on their trails. You can often see them carrying it back to their colony, which also gives away their entrance to the house so I can seal it after they've ended their parade. It takes 1 to 2 weeks to completely eradicate them, but it's pretty effective. You can also take some narrow masking tape, bend it to a right angle and make a little shelf to put it on. I use the used tops of canning jars for the liquid bait. High enough to hold the liquid, but low enough to give easy access. I use (by weight) 1 part borax, 5 parts sugar, 14 parts water. This ends up at 5% borax by weight, which is what is shown on Terro traps. Works for Argentina ants in the Bay Area. Thanks Jason, I love your content.
